Seekonk, Massachusetts, nestled in the vibrant Greater Providence area with a population of just over 15,000, boasts a charming food scene that reflects its rich New England heritage. The town’s proximity to the ocean infuses local cuisine with fresh seafood, making dishes like clam chowder and stuffed quahogs popular staples. Notably, the famous restaurant “The Hungry Ghost” offers a modern twist on classic favorites, showcasing locally sourced ingredients. Seekonk’s history as a former agricultural hub further enriches its culinary traditions, with local farms supplying fresh produce that enhances seasonal dishes, thereby connecting residents to the region’s agricultural roots. The town’s geographic setting, bordered by the Seekonk River and lush wooded areas, also provides a picturesque backdrop for dining and enjoying the finest of New England’s flavors.

Howard Johnson’s Restaurant was located at 821 Fall River Ave, Seekonk, MA 02771.
